Marks, Maurice writes:
 > 
 > I'm trying to boot a DS20 with the 10/31 4.0 snapshot. It gets as far as the
 > "probing for i/o devices" screen, then after 24 hours or so continues to the
 > install option screen. It apparently fails to recognize the SCSI controller
 > because it sees no disk devices. This system has a dual port NCR 53C875 SCSI
 > controller combo card (which also includes a DE500 (Tulip) ethernet
 > controller. I believed that the NCR 53C875 was on the supported list, but
 > maybe its isnt. Any ideas?
 > 
 > /maurice
 > 

The 10/31 snapshot is broken for DS20 & xp1000.  Current on these
machines was broken on 10/14 and fixed on 11/03 in rev 1.128 of
sys/pci/pci.c

We need a new alpha snapshot.  There have been some significant bug
fixes since 10/31.   Jordan?
